- The distance between Dalwhinnie, Scotland, Uk and Borzja, Russia is approximately 6,905 km or 4,291 mi.
- To reach Dalwhinnie, Scotland in this distance one would set out from Borzja bearing 328°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Dalwhinnie, Scotland bearing 218.3° or SW .
- Dalwhinnie, Scotland has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Borzja has a boreal subarctic climate with dry winters (Dwc).
- Dalwhinnie, Scotland is in or near the boreal rain forest biome whereas Borzja is in or near the boreal dry scrub biome.
- The average annual temperature is 8.6 °C (15.4°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 33.2 °C (59.8°F) less in Dalwhinnie, Scotland.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 915.6 mm (36 in) more which is equivalent to 915.6 l/m² (22.47 US gal/ft²) or 9,156,000 l/ha (978,837 US gal/ac) more. About 4 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 6.5° lower in Dalwhinnie, Scotland than in Borzja.
